Silver(I)-organophosphane complexes of the dihydridobis(3-nitro-1,2,4-triazolyl)borate ligand. X-ray crystal structure of {[H2B(tzNO2)2]Ag[P(m-tolyl)3]2} with the scorpionate ligand co-ordinated in an unidentate k1-N fashion

abstract:
New silver(I) complexes have been synthesised from the reaction of AgNO3, monodentate PR3 (PR3 = P(o-tolyl)3, P(m-tolyl)3, P(ptolyl)
3, P(p-C6H4F), SeP(C6H5)3) or bidentate tertiary (dppe = bis(diphenylphosphane)ethane, dppf = 1,10-bis(diphenylphosphane)ferrocene)
phosphanes and potassium dihydrobis(3-nitro-1,2,4-triazolyl)borate, K[H2B(tzNO2)2]. These compounds have been characterized
by elemental analyses, FT-IR, ESI-MS and multinuclear (1H and 31P) NMR spectral data. The adduct {[H2B(tzNO2)2]Ag[P(m-tolyl)3]2}
has been characterized by single crystal X-ray studies. In the former, the H2B(tzNO2)2 acts as a monodentate ligand utilizing the coordinating
capability of only one of the additional (exo-) ring nitrogens to complete the coordination array about the silver atom.
